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Staplehurst to Woodsmoor start from as little as £49.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Staplehurst to Woodsmoor start from £87.30 one way, or £124.80 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Staplehurst to Woodsmoor are available for £217.00 one way, or £434.00 return

Facilities and Amenities

Staplehurst Station is equipped with a range of facilities to ensure a smooth journey. You can purchase tickets or collect pre-booked ones from the conveniently located ticket office, open from 6:00 to 19:00 on weekdays, and with slightly shorter hours over the weekend. There are also accessible ticket machines available.

For those with accessibility needs, Staplehurst Station has step-free access throughout, so getting to your platform is hassle-free. This station's commitment to accessibility is commendable, offering ramps for train access and step-free routes via lifts between platforms.

Comfort and Safety at the Station

Your visit to Staplehurst won’t lack comfort, as the station provides seating areas and accessible toilets. While there is no formal waiting room, there's always a spot to relax before your train arrives. On the safety side, the station features CCTV, providing peace of mind as you travel.

If you're feeling peckish or need to grab a quick coffee, check out the refreshment facilities, including a coffee kiosk and Selecta vending machines. Though there isn't an ATM or currency exchange service on-site, there's a selection of shops for additional convenience.

Onward Travel and Connectivity

Once you've arrived at Staplehurst Station, the next step is finding your onward travel. Taxis are conveniently located next to the station, making it easy to transition from train to taxi without missing a beat. If you need to plan further, information about local bus services is available, ensuring connectivity to your next destination.

Facilities and Amenities

At Woodsmoor station, ticket purchasing is straightforward with a ticket office operating between 07:10 to 10:10 on weekdays. For those who prefer self-service, ticket machines are available for purchasing and collecting tickets bought online. Travelers with smartcards will find validators handy for both entry and exit. While the station isn’t entirely step-free, there is partial access—important details for those with mobility challenges. Note that there's no waiting room, but seating is available on the platform. Unfortunately, the station lacks refreshment facilities, shops, and bicycle storage.

Accessibility and Customer Support

Woodsmoor station strives to assist every passenger effectively. Though there aren’t any staff help points available, support is just a phone call away via the helpline at 08002006060. For those with hearing impairments, the station is equipped with induction loops, but accessible ticket machines aren't part of the current amenities. Level access is offered toward Manchester services; however, it's essential to note that there are steps involved elsewhere in the station for access to trains heading towards Buxton.

Getting Around

Transport links at Woodsmoor leave room for improvement, with no immediate bus stops or cycling facilities present. Nonetheless, in situations like rail replacement service scenarios, buses to Manchester and Stockport are conveniently accessed on Bramhall Lane. Taxis can be organized, though they are not stationed at the station itself. For metro connections, travelers might need to look a bit beyond the immediate vicinity, though assistance information via GMPTE is available at 0161 228 7811. For those seeking quick and easy transport, cab services can be booked online.
